Hosts Justin Stewart and Dr. Antija Allen are joined by Black People Die By Suicide Too [BPDBST]. Initially conceived as a podcast, BPDBST is an organization with a vision to end suicide in the Black community, dedicated to normalizing the conversation about suicide through education and resources that instill hope in Black people suffering from mental health conditions. Jordan Scott serves as the community outreach/peer support manager, co-founder, and board member. Brittany Hanani is a dedicated advocate, therapist, and board President.
